Test-plan note — Forgecrumb factory library

Plugin authors: cover custom trait registration, seeded randomness reproducibility, and nested factory overrides. Snapshot outputs must be deterministic across runs with the same seed. Integration checks run against the hosted fixture service, which requires authentication. Use the token below for those calls.

session JWT of yawep-yawep = eyJhbGciOiJIUzI1NiIsInR5cCI6IkpXVCJ9.eyJzdWIiOiI3pWF3_In0.aXYsHiog

## Escalation: Idempotency Keys on Payment Retries

If your plugin retries a charge through the Lumpay gateway, reuse the same idempotency key — minting a new one per retry is the number-one cause of duplicate charges we see. Keys expire after 48 hours, so retries beyond that window need a fresh key and a reconciliation check first. If you're seeing duplicate-charge reports despite correct key reuse, grab the gateway request IDs and escalate to the Lumpay payments triage team at the address below.

escalation mailbox, hadug-bajog: sormir@norvalabs.internal

## v2.11.0 — Watchdog defaults changed

The Kioskwright watchdog now restarts the shell after 20 seconds of unresponsiveness rather than 60, and escalates to a full device reboot after three consecutive restarts instead of five. This reduced blank-screen reports at the Verlan pilot sites by roughly 70%. Please verify signage fleets before broad rollout. Production units will boot with these values.

service settings:
PRAIX_LOG_LEVEL=error
PRAIX_METRICS_HOST=metrics.praix.qorvelcorp.corp
PRAIX_POOL_SIZE=16